Understanding the Double Chop Harvester


The double chop harvester is distinguished by its ability to chop crops into smaller pieces while harvesting. This feature is essential for maximizing the nutritional value of forage, which is primarily used for livestock feed. The harvester works by cutting the plant at ground level and simultaneously chopping it into fine particles. These smaller pieces are then easily transported and stored, reducing the time required for handling and ensuring that feed remains fresh and manageable.


The machine operates based on a series of high-speed blades that create a clean cut without damaging the plant. The versatility offered by a double chop harvester makes it ideal for various crops, including corn, sorghum, and ryegrass. Farmers can expect more uniform particle sizes, which facilitate better fermentation in silage production—a crucial process for preserving feed quality.


Benefits of Using a Double Chop Harvester


1. Time Efficiency Traditional harvesting methods typically involve multiple steps—cutting, chopping, and collecting the crop. The double chop harvester combines these processes into one, significantly reducing the time required for harvest. This enhanced efficiency allows farmers to focus on other critical tasks and ultimately increases their productivity.

2. Improved Crop Management By chopping crops into smaller pieces, the double chop harvester aids in better packing and storage, essential for silage production. The uniformity of the chopped pieces promotes anaerobic fermentation, which is vital for preserving the nutritional content of the forage. As a result, farmers can provide their livestock with high-quality feed throughout the year.


3. Reduced Labor Costs Mechanizing the harvesting process reduces the need for manual labor, which can be a significant cost burden for farmers. With fewer workers required for the overall harvesting process, farmers can allocate their resources more efficiently and potentially invest in other areas of their operations.


4. Precision and Adaptability Modern double chop harvesters come equipped with advanced technologies that allow for precise cutting and chopping. Features such as adjustable chopping lengths and variable speed settings enable farmers to tailor the operation to their specific crop types and conditions, thus optimizing their harvesting strategy.


5. Environmental Benefits The double chop harvester contributes to sustainable farming practices. By efficiently processing crop residues, it enhances soil health and reduces the need for chemical fertilizers. Furthermore, the ability to handle crops directly contributes to decreasing fuel consumption and emissions associated with transport and processing.
